Schwartz-Spector

Lisa Ann Schwartz, daughter of Bob Schwartz of Peru, Ind., and Shelley Mandel of Chesterfield, and Kevin Robert Spector, son of Alan and Ann Spector of Cincinnati, were married May 20, 2006, at the Popponesset Inn in Mashpee, Mass., where Rabbi David Freelund officiated. A wedding reception followed the ceremony at the Popponesset Inn. She is the granddaughter of Harvey and Terry Hieken and Harry and Katie Schwartz.

He is the grandson of Alvin and Lenore Sachar and the late Jeanette and the late Herman Spector and Molly Spector. The bride chose Sara Uribe, her sister, as matron of honor. Julie Schwartz, sister of the bride, was maid of honor. Bridesmaids were Rebecca Schwartz, sister of the bride; Rachel Schwartz, sister of the bride; Emily Vlk, cousin of the groom; Dana DeBlasi, sister of the groom.

The groom chose Thomas Marshall and Jason Wise as best men. Groomsmen were William Girasuolo, Doug Kenner, Mark Land, and Marc Stern.

Following a wedding trip to Fiji, the couple resides in Cambridge, Mass.

Mirowitzes celebrate 53 years

Saul and Barbara Mirowitz recently celebrated their 53rd wedding anniversary at the Ritz-Carlton Hotel in Clayton.

The party was arranged by their children, Marilyn (Marty) Levison, Wendy (Steve) Goldberg, Jan (Sender) Axelbaum and Jill (David) Mogil.

Barbara and Saul renewed their wedding vows in a surprise ceremony officiated by Rabbi Ephraim Zimand of Traditional Congregation.

Touching speeches were delivered by the daughters, followed by dinner and dancing.

Goldbergs celebrate 50 years

Elaine and Oscar Goldberg recently celebrated their 50th wedding anniversary. They celebrated with a cruise to the Southern Caribbean with their children and grandchildren. In addition, they were honored at Congregation B’nai Amoona with a special Kiddush luncheon.
